Boost Your Brand with Social Media Management

In today's digital world, social media is more than just a platform for sharing photos and updates. It has become a powerful tool for businesses to connect with their audience, build brand awareness, and drive sales. If you want to boost your brand, effective social media management is essential.


Social media management involves creating, scheduling, analyzing, and engaging with content posted on social media platforms. It is not just about posting updates; it is about creating a strategy that aligns with your business goals.


In this post, we will explore the importance of social media management, the key components of a successful strategy, and practical tips to enhance your brand's online presence.


Why Social Media Management Matters


Social media management is crucial for several reasons.


First, it helps you reach a wider audience. With billions of users on plat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ter, your potential customer base is vast.


Second, social media allows for direct interaction with your audience. You can respond to comments, answer questions, and engage with your followers in real-time. This interaction builds trust and loyalty, which are vital for any brand.


Third, effective social media management can improve your brand's visibility. Regularly posting quality content keeps your brand in front of your audience, making it more likely they will remember you when they need your products or services.


Finally, social media provides valuable insights into your audience's preferences and behaviors. By analyzing engagement metrics, you can tailor your content to better meet their needs.


Key Components of a Successful Social Media Strategy


Creating a successful social media strategy involves several key components.


1. Define Your Goals


Before you start posting, it is essential to define your goals. What do you want to achieve through social media?


Some common goals include:


  • Increasing brand awareness

  • Driving website traffic

  • Generating leads

  • Boosting sales

  • Improving customer engagement


Having clear goals will guide your content creation and help you measure success.


2. Know Your Audience


Understanding your target audience is crucial for effective social media management.


Consider the following questions:


  • Who are your ideal customers?

  • What are their interests and preferences?

  • Which social media platforms do they use?


By knowing your audience, you can create content that resonates with them and encourages engagement.


3. Choose the Right Platforms


Not all social media platforms are created equal. Each platform has its unique audience and content style.


For example:


  • Facebook is great for building community and sharing news.

  • Instagram is ideal for visual content and storytelling.

  • Twitter is perfect for real-time updates and customer service.


Choose the platforms that align with your audience and goals.


4. Create Engaging Content


Content is king in the world of social media. To capture your audience's attention, you need to create engaging and relevant content.


Consider using a mix of content types, such as:


  • Images and videos

  • Blog posts and articles

  • Polls and quizzes

  • User-generated content


Make sure your content is visually appealing and provides value to your audience.


5. Develop a Posting Schedule


Consistency is key in social media management. Developing a posting schedule helps you stay organized and ensures you are regularly engaging with your audience.


Consider using social media management tools to schedule your posts in advance. This allows you to maintain a consistent presence without having to post in real-time.


6. Monitor and Analyze Performance


To improve your social media strategy, you need to monitor and analyze your performance regularly.


Look at metrics such as:


  • Engagement rates (likes, shares, comments)

  • Follower growth

  • Website traffic from social media

  • Conversion rates


Use this data to adjust your strategy and improve your content.


Practical Tips for Effective Social Media Management


Now that you understand the key components of a successful social media strategy, here are some practical tips to enhance your brand's online presence.


1. Be Authentic


Authenticity is essential in building trust with your audience. Share your brand's story, values, and mission.


Show the human side of your brand by sharing behind-the-scenes content or employee spotlights. This helps create a connection with your audience.


2. Engage with Your Audience


Social media is a two-way street. Don't just post content and walk away. Engage with your audience by responding to comments and messages.


Ask questions and encourage discussions. This interaction fosters a sense of community and keeps your audience coming back for more.


3. Use Hashtags Wisely


Hashtags can help increase your content's visibility, but using them wisely is crucial.


Research relevant hashtags in your industry and include them in your posts. However, avoid overloading your posts with hashtags, as this can come across as spammy.


4. Collaborate with Influencers


Partnering with influencers can help you reach a broader audience.


Identify influencers in your niche who align with your brand values. Collaborate on content or campaigns to tap into their audience and boost your brand's visibility.


5. Stay Updated on Trends


Social media is constantly evolving, and staying updated on trends is essential.


Follow industry news and keep an eye on emerging platforms and features. Adapting to trends can help you stay relevant and engage your audience effectively.


The Power of Social Media Advertising


While organic reach is essential, social media advertising can significantly boost your brand's visibility.


Platforms like Facebook and Instagram offer targeted advertising options that allow you to reach specific demographics.


Consider investing in social media ads to promote your products, services, or special offers. This can help you reach a larger audience and drive traffic to your website.


Measuring Success: Key Metrics to Track


To determine the effectiveness of your social media management efforts, you need to track key metrics.


Some important metrics to consider include:


  • Engagement Rate: This measures how well your audience interacts with your content. A higher engagement rate indicates that your content resonates with your audience.


  • Reach and Impressions: Reach refers to the number of unique users who see your content, while impressions measure how many times your content is displayed. Both metrics help you understand your content's visibility.


  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): This metric measures how many users click on your links compared to how many people see your posts. A higher CTR indicates that your content is compelling and encourages action.


  • Conversion Rate: This measures how many users take a desired action, such as making a purchase or signing up for a newsletter. Tracking conversion rates helps you understand the effectiveness of your social media campaigns.


By regularly monitoring these metrics, you can make informed decisions to improve your social media strategy.
